Re: Got a tune up to 545RWHP

If you're an inexperienced drag racer with that much HP, stock clutch and street tires, you will probably have a hard time hooking up. You might get into the 11's if you can figure out the launch. Otherwise I would guess low 12's.

A word of caution... if the car gets sideways, get out of the throttle and don't get back on it. The race is over at that point and it's not worth hitting the wall. I've watched several of my friends do that very thing.

Have fun, play safe.
